Textbook outcome (TO) is a comprehensive quality metric for cardiothoracic surgery. Achieving TO improves survival and lowers costs, but definitions need standardization for broader use.

Background:

  • Textbook outcome (TO) offers a multidimensional quality metric beyond traditional single indicators.
  • It integrates oncologic adequacy, complication avoidance, reintervention/readmission rates, and discharge time for an ideal perioperative course.
  • TO addresses the complexity of cardiothoracic care, including lung and esophageal resections, lung transplantation, and cardiac surgery.

Purpose of the Study:

  • To systematically review the definition, incidence, determinants, prognostic impact, and limitations of TO in cardiothoracic surgery.
  • To synthesize evidence on TO across various cardiothoracic procedures.
  • To identify barriers and propose future directions for TO implementation.

Main Methods:

  • Systematic review adhering to PRISMA guidelines.
  • Inclusion of studies on lung/esophageal resections, lung transplantation, cardiac surgery, and adult heart transplantation.
  • Synthesis of evidence on TO definition, incidence, determinants, prognostic impact, and limitations.

Main Results:

  • TO achievement rates vary widely (24%-66% in thoracic, 30% Norwood, 37%-45% heart transplant, 52% lung transplant).
  • Achieving TO correlates with improved survival, reduced costs, and better benchmarking.
  • Failure determinants include inadequate lymph node dissection, prolonged operative time, comorbidities, pretransplant support, and socioeconomic factors.

Conclusions:

  • Harmonized, procedure-specific TO sets and integration of equity-sensitive risk adjustment are recommended.
  • Prospective validation of TO metrics is necessary.
  • Standardized TO is essential for quality assessment and improvement in cardiothoracic surgery.
